Overspeed
Detect Operation in Excess of Design Speed.
• Detect overspeed in excess of 115% of critical lift speed
• Detect overspeed in excess of 115% of non-critical lift
speed
• Brakes are automatically applied when an overspeed
fault is detected
Drive Train Discontinuity
Detect Difference Between Drum and Motor Speed.
• Detect incorrect drum movement (Speed Differential)
• Response time may vary based on existing driveline
design
• Brakes are automatically applied when drive train
discontinuity is detected
Differential Motion
Compare the direction and speed of the hoist to the direction
and speed initiated by the operator.
• Response time may vary based on existing drive
acceleration, deceleration and operator reverse plugging
• Brakes are automatically applied when differential motion
is detected
Commanded Not Operated
When the equipment does not respond to a command to operate.
• Detect lack of drum movement when drum movement is
initiated by the operator
• Detect failure of encoder feedback and control circuit
• Response time may vary based on existing driveline
design and drive torque proof testing
• Brakes are automatically applied when a commanded not
operated fault is detected
In Motion
Operator notification of hoist up and down motion
that is independent of the hoist control circuit providing
compliance with NOG6411.6(f)
• Detect upward or downward drum movement and prompt
operator

Uncommanded
Motion
Detect drum movement not initiated by operator input or drum movement in the
wrong direction.
• Detect incorrect upward or downward drum movement.
• Detect reversal of drum rotation.
• Response time may vary based on hoist drive deceleration
or operator initiation of reverse plugging.
• Brakes are automatically applied when an uncommanded
fault is detected
Watch
Dog Circuit
Independent
hard wired circuit to detect failure of the SafWatch™ processors
and power supply. • Detect
5 VDC and 12 VDC power supply failure. • Detect
MCU (Microchip PIC series Microcontroller)
hardware or software failure. • Detect
CPLD (Complex Programmable Logic Device)
hardware or software failure. • Brakes
are automatically applied when a watch dog fault is
detected.
Encoder
Line Receiver
Unique
encoder line receivers utilized for hoist motor and drum
direction / speed feedback to increase reliability and
fault detection.
• Allows the use of quadrature differential encoders for long
distance operation. • +/-15kV
ESD (Electrostatic Discharge) protection,
increased common mode rejection. • Alarm
flags to indicate open, shorted line conditions,
excessive common-mode voltage range, and low-signal
strength. • Brakes
may be automatically applied when an encoder
alarm is detected.
Modular
Input / Output Units Rack
mounted modular I/O units to allow a mix of analog, digital,
and serial inputs and outputs at different voltage levels. • UL
recognized rack and I/O modules ranging from 5 VDC
to 240 VAC. • Up
to 8 rack slots available for a total of 32 digital input
or
outputs. • Analog
and serial modules supported.
